Output 09349c73cce4d309b917db9ea8087cc2424ef38ac134ec8c25bd27d72e7677b3:0

value
104390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c90f35586c0aacb64896a97ad17b7eb3e757f8 OP_EQUAL
address
3HSd1Pe4SXyTU6DyrPmYvkNbg9MCpEUgZ7
transaction
09349c73cce4d309b917db9ea8087cc2424ef38ac134ec8c25bd27d72e7677b3
confirmations
205026
spent
true